Živimo do ponedeljka ili kako preživeti Crni petak

Sutra je Crni petak - za internet projekte to znači da će biti vršna opterećenja na sajtu. Čak im ni divovi možda neće moći izdržati, npr. Desilo se sa Amazonom na Prime Dayu 2017. 

Živimo do ponedeljka ili kako preživeti Crni petak

Odlučili smo navesti nekoliko jednostavnih primjera rada sa virtuelnim serverom kako bismo izbjegli greške i ne pozdravili ljude sa 503 stranicom ili, još gore, About:blank i ERR_CONNECTION_TIMED_OUT. Ostao je još jedan dan za pripremu.

Skaliranje resursa

Web stranica se obično sastoji od različitih modula - baze podataka, web servera, sistema za keširanje. Svaki od ovih modula zahtijeva različite vrste i količine resursa. Potrebno je unaprijed analizirati količinu resursa koji se troši korištenjem stres testova i procijeniti I/O brzinu diska, procesorsko vrijeme, memoriju i propusnost Interneta vaše stranice.

Testovi stresa će vam pomoći da prepoznate uska grla u vašem sistemu i unaprijed ih povećate. Tako, na primjer, možete poboljšati snagu vašeg servera povećanjem prostora na tvrdom disku za vrijeme trajanja promocije, proširiti propusni opseg web stranice ili povećati RAM virtualnog servera. Nakon promocije možete vratiti sve kako je bilo, to se radi na vašem ličnom računu bez kontaktiranja tehničke podrške i traje par minuta, ali je bolje to učiniti unaprijed i tokom sati minimalne aktivnosti korisnika na stranici.

Zaštitite se od DDoS napada unaprijed

Web stranice padaju tokom prodajnih dana ne samo zbog povećanja priliva kupaca, već i zbog DDoS napada. Mogu ih organizirati napadači koji žele preusmjeriti vaš promet na svoje phishing resurse. 

DDoS napadi svakim danom postaju sve sofisticiraniji. Hakeri koriste različite pristupe, koristeći i DDoS napade i napade na ranjivosti aplikacija. U većini slučajeva, napadi su praćeni pokušajima hakovanja stranice.

Ovdje je također važno da se unaprijed pripremite i povežete IP adresu zaštićenu od napada na vaš server. U UltraVDS-u štitimo servere ne nakon napada, već 1.5 sata dnevno i dosljedno izdržavamo napade do XNUMX Tbps! Da bi se serveri zaštitili od DDoS napada, koristi se niz filtera koji su povezani na Internet kanal sa dovoljno velikom propusnošću. Filteri dosljedno analiziraju prolazni promet, identificirajući anomalije i neuobičajene mrežne aktivnosti. Analizirani nestandardni obrasci saobraćaja uključuju sve trenutno poznate metode napada, uključujući i one implementirane pomoću distribuiranih botneta.

Da biste povezali zaštićenu adresu sa virtuelnim serverom, morate unapred podneti zahtev službi podrške provajdera.

Ubrzajte učitavanje stranice

Tokom perioda promocija, opterećenje na serverima se povećava, a fotografijama i karticama proizvoda je potrebno dosta vremena da se učitaju na web stranice. Takođe, učitavanje stranica otežavaju različiti okviri, JS biblioteke, CSS moduli i tako dalje. Potencijalni klijent može napustiti stranicu bez da dobije odgovor sa stranice, čak i ako je ponuda povoljnija od ponude konkurenata. Za provjeru brzine učitavanja stranice predlažemo korištenje Google DevTools.

Mreža za isporuku sadržaja (CDN) može pomoći da se ubrza učitavanje stranice. CDN je geografski distribuirana mreža koja se sastoji od čvorova za keširanje – tačaka prisutnosti, mogu se nalaziti u cijelom svijetu. Prilikom posete sajtu, klijent će dobiti statički sadržaj ne sa vašeg servera, već sa onog koji je deo CDN mreže i koji se nalazi bliže njemu. Skraćivanjem rute između servera i klijenta, podaci na sajtu se brže učitavaju.

Možete sami postaviti CDN mrežu ako imate VDS na Windows Server Core 2019; da biste to učinili, koristite alate ugrađene u operativni sistem kao što su: Active Directory, DFS, IIS, WinAcme, RSAT. Možete koristiti i gotova rješenja, na primjer, CDN iz Cloudflarea bi mogao riješiti problem mnogo brže i jeftinije. Plus, ovaj sistem ima dodatne karakteristike: DNS, HTML kompresiju, CSS, JS, mnoge tačke prisutnosti.

Sretno sa prodajom.

Crni petak u UltraVDS-u

Nismo zanemarili ni tradicionalne popuste ovog dana i korisnicima Habra nudimo promotivni kod BlackFr sa 15% popusta na sve naše virtuelne servere od 28. novembra do zaključno 2. decembra.

Na primjer, VDS server po UltraLight tarifi sa 1 CPU jezgrom, 500MB RAM-a i 10GB diskovnog prostora sa Windows Server Core 2019 možete kupiti uz pomoć promotivnog koda BlackFr uz dodatnih 30% popusta za godinu dana za samo 55 rubalja mjesečno, tako da će ukupan popust iznositi 45% trenutne cijene.

UltraVDS je moderan cloud provajder; stotine velikih organizacija rade sa nama, uključujući poznate banke, berzanske posrednike, građevinske i farmaceutske kompanije. 

Živimo do ponedeljka ili kako preživeti Crni petak

izvor: www.habr.com

Dodajte komentar